... Read moreWhen it comes to decorating a room, the choices can be overwhelming. Start by assessing the purpose of the space, whether it will be used for entertaining, relaxation, or work. Use color theory to influence the mood—soft colors typically create a calming atmosphere, while brighter colors can energize the space. Incorporate layers of lighting, such as ambient, task, and accent lighting, to enhance the room's functionality and aesthetic appeal. Incorporating your personality into your decor can also make a significant impact. Use personal items like photographs, artwork, or souvenirs from travels to give the room character. Consider mixing textures and materials, such as wood, metal, and fabric, to create visual interest. Plants can also breathe life into a space, providing not only beauty but also improved air quality. Don't forget about furniture placement—arranging furniture in a way that encourages conversation and flow is key. Finally, keep it organized; a clutter-free space promotes tranquility and functionality. By following these tips, you can create a space that is both stylish and reflective of your personal style.
